原文:ElasticSearch如何一次查詢出全部數據

使用from size進行分頁查詢 深度分頁 ,當數據量大的時候,對全部數據進行遍歷,使用from size性能會很差。from指的是從哪里開始拿數據,size是結果集中返回的文檔個數。from size的工作原理是:如size amp from ,那么Elasticsearch會從每個分片里取出 條數據,然后匯集到一起再排序,取出 序號的文檔。由此可見,from size的效率必然不會很高,特別 ...

2021-03-26 18:52 0 1561 推薦指數:

查看詳情

ElasticSearch如何一次查詢全部數據——基於Scroll

Elasticsearch 查詢結果默認只顯示10條,可以通過設置from及size來達到分頁的效果(詳見附3),但是 from + size <= 10,000,因為index.max_result_window 默認值是10,000,而 from+ size 必須小於 ...

Thu Dec 05 22:19:00 CST 2019 0 2451
一次 ElasticSearch 搜索優化

一次 ElasticSearch 搜索優化 1. 環境 ES6.3.2,索引名稱 user_v1,5個主分片,每個分片一個副本。分片基本都在11GB左右,GET _cat/shards/user 一共有3.4億文檔,主分片總共57GB。 Segment信息:curl -X GET ...

Thu Mar 21 06:22:00 CST 2019 0 1960
一次ES查詢數據突然變為空的問題

基本環境 elasticsearch版本:6.3.1 客戶端環境:kibana 6.3.4、Java8應用程序模塊。 其中kibana主要用於數據查詢診斷和查閱日志,Java8為主要的客戶端,數據插入和查詢都是由Java實現的。 案例介紹 使用elasticsearch存儲訂單 ...

Tue Nov 05 15:34:00 CST 2019 0 569
記錄一次redis scan查詢不到數據的BUG

因需要清理redis緩存,然后我們存的key是動態的,比如 redisKey+aId+bId,value 這種,所以需要用到模糊查詢出來再清除。 網上一頓操作,就你了: 結果發現數據查詢不出來,即使剛插入的數據也顯示不了,只能查固定數據,模糊的查不到!接下來改了幾個版本 ...

Fri May 07 01:11:00 CST 2021 1 1878
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M